Luzerne County, PA (Pennsylvania) voted R+19.1 for Donald Trump (Republican) in the 2024 presidential election, with Trump receiving 92,444 votes (59.1%) to 62,504 (39.96%) for Harris.

This represents a R+4.8% swing toward Republicans compared to 2020. Luzerne County is classified as a solid Republican county. Luzerne County has voted Republican in every presidential election since 2016. The county has a population of approximately 327,675.
